πένθος, -ους, τό,[in LXX chiefly for אֵבֶל;]mourning: Ja 4:9, Re 18:7, 821:4.†
πενιχρός, -ά, -όν(< πένομαι, v.s. πένης), [in LXX: Ex 22:25 (עָנִי), Pr 28:1529:7 (דַּל)*;] chiefly in Comic poets and late prose (but Plato, Rep., 578 A), = πένης,needy, poor: ...
πεντάκις,adv.,five times: II Co 11:24.†
πεντακισ-χίλιοι, -αι, -α,five thousand: Mt 14:2116:9, Mk 6:448:19, Lk 9:14, Jo 6:10.†
πεντακόσιοι, -αι, -α,five hundred: Lk 7:41, I Co 15:6.†
πέντε, indecl., οἱ, αἱ, τά,five: Mt 14:17, al.
πεντε-και-δέκατος, -η, -ον,the fifteenth: Lk 3:1.†
πεντήκοντα, indecl., οἱ, αἱ, τά,fifty: Lk 7:4116:6, Jo 8:5721:11, Ac 13:20; ἀνὰ π., Lk 9:14; κατὰ π., Mk 6:40.†

* περαιτέρω(< πέρα, beyond),compar. adv.,beyond: Ac 19:39, L, Tr., WH (T, Rec., R, περὶ ἑτέρων).†

Πέργαμος, -ου, ἡ(so Xen., Paus., al., but -ον, τό in Strabo, Polyb., and most writers, also in Inscr.; in NT the termination is uncertain),Pergamum, a city of Mysia: Re 1:112:12.†
Πέργη, -ης, ἡ,Perga, a city of Pamphylia: Ac 13:13, 1414:25.†

** περι-άπτω,[in LXX: III Mac 3:7*;]1. to tie about, attach.2. In late writers, to light a fire around, kindle: πῦρ, Lk 22:55.†
**† περι-αστράπτω,[in LXX: IV Mac 4:10*;]to flash around: c. acc., Ac 9:3; seq. περίAc 22:6 (Eccl. and Byzant.).†

περι-βλέπω,[in LXX for שׁוּר, etc.;]to look around (at). Mid., to look about one (at): absol., Mk 9:810:23; c. inf., Mk 5:32; c. acc. pers., Mk 3:5, 34, Lk 6:10; πάντα, Mk 11:11.†

περι-δέω,[in LXX: Jb 12:18 (אסר)*;]to tie round, bind round: c. acc. et dat., pass., Jo 11:44.†
** περι-εργάζομαι,[in LXX: Wi 8:5 א1, Si 3:23*;]1. to waste one's labour about a thing.2. to be a busybody: II Th 3:11 (cf. Plat., Apol., 19 B).†
